Who knows kreature. I guess that would just prolong the agony and perpetuate uncertainty, as each time they would have this kind of "cliff edge" funding requirement before running out of cash. Whereas $600m gets them to production, and revenue, so hopefully no more cliff edges.

We can all take a view on this and there are only so many options. The funding will either be raised or it won't. And if funding is raised it will either be debt or equity or some kind of joint venture (which is not too dissimilar to an equity raise, with perhaps the added benefit of splitting the then future costs with another party) or some combination.

If funding is not raised, obviously the share price will trend towards zero. But to me all other scenarios lead to a likely profit from here and some scenarios might even lead to eventual profit for longer term holders. What I am suggesting is that even if all the $600m is raised through new shares issued at today's prices (which is not what I think will actually happen), there is more value in this for current holders than 3p per share.

For years I have been an admirer of this project and wanted to invest, but always thought the risks were discounted too readily by investors and as a result the share price too high. That equation has now changed. The finance risk has always been there - that has not really changed - but it is now very much factored into the current price in my view.

So I am long now and, like everyone else, just talking my book.....
